Overview
Elastic Enterprise Search
Elastic Enterprise Search gives you the tools to build and manage sophisticated search experiences for your customers and employees. Whether you are adding a search bar to your website or connecting fragmented internal data, you can unify your content into a single, searchable interface. The platform combines traditional keyword search with modern AI and vector search, ensuring your users find exactly what they need regardless of how they phrase their queries.
You can easily ingest data from various sources like Google Drive, Slack, and GitHub using pre-built connectors. The solution is designed for developers who need flexibility and for business teams who want to tune search relevance without writing code. It scales with your data growth, providing a reliable foundation for everything from simple site search to complex, RAG-based AI applications.
Sinequa
Sinequa helps you surface the right information at the right time, no matter where it lives in your organization. By connecting to hundreds of enterprise applications like SharePoint, Salesforce, and Box, the platform creates a unified search experience that understands the context of your queries. You can stop wasting hours hunting for documents and start using your company's collective intelligence to make faster, more informed decisions.
The platform is designed for large-scale organizations in data-heavy industries like life sciences, manufacturing, and financial services. It uses natural language processing and machine learning to go beyond simple keyword matching, providing you with direct answers and relevant insights from millions of documents. Whether you are looking for research papers, technical manuals, or expert colleagues, you can find exactly what you need through a single, intuitive interface.

Elastic Enterprise Search Features
- Pre-built Connectors Sync your data instantly from popular tools like Salesforce, SharePoint, and Slack with ready-to-use integration modules.
- Vector Search Implement semantic search capabilities so your users find relevant results based on meaning and intent rather than just keywords.
- Search UI Components Build beautiful search interfaces quickly using a library of open-source React components designed for seamless user experiences.
- Relevance Tuning Adjust search results manually with easy-to-use sliders and weights to ensure your most important content appears first.
- Web Crawler Ingest and index content from your public websites automatically to keep your search results fresh and up to date.
- Analytics Dashboard Monitor what your users are searching for and identify content gaps to improve your overall search performance.
Sinequa Features
- Neural Search. Find information using natural language queries that understand your intent rather than just matching basic keywords.
- Smart Connectors. Connect to over 200 enterprise data sources out-of-the-box to index all your content in one place.
- Generative AI Integration. Get direct, conversational answers synthesized from your own secure corporate data using integrated large language models.
- Expert Finder. Identify and connect with subject matter experts within your organization based on the content they have created.
- Multi-Language Support. Search and analyze documents in over 35 languages with automated translation and cross-lingual capabilities.
- Usage Analytics. Track search patterns and content gaps to understand what information your team needs most frequently.

Pros & Cons
Elastic Enterprise Search
Pros
- Extremely fast search results even with massive datasets
- Highly customizable relevance tuning for specific business needs
- Seamless integration with the broader Elastic Stack ecosystem
- Excellent documentation and active developer community support
Cons
- Significant learning curve for non-technical administrators
- Resource-based pricing can become unpredictable as data grows
- Initial configuration requires dedicated engineering time
Sinequa
Pros
- Exceptional ability to index massive, complex datasets
- Highly customizable interface for different department needs
- Powerful natural language processing understands technical jargon
- Robust security features respect existing document permissions
Cons
- Significant technical expertise required for initial setup
- High total cost of ownership for smaller teams
- Search relevance tuning requires ongoing administrative effort
